what kind of dog is this in a Caesar dog food commercial?

on tv we keep seeing a ceasar dog food commercial in which it says all dogs wanna be a ceasar dog, the dogs are real big and one of them wants to ride in a bike basket but hes to big toward the end a lady is sitting in a chair hidden by a huge white dog, my question is what kind of dog is it, it kinda looks like a golden retreiver but bigger and white

Update:

not the little dog yes hes a west highland terrier this dog is HUGE not the little tiny one

Update 2:

the commercial start out with a large dog trying to fit thru a little blue doggie door

    The first one, climbing through the dog door, is an Old English Sheepdog. Second, is a black and white Great Dane. The third, sitting on the lady's lap, is a Great Pyrenees. Last, is the small West Highland White Terrier.
